The Life And Times Of Henry VIII – Robert Lacey |
Description: The accession of Henry VIII was greeted with rapture by his subjects: young, handsome, and open-handed, the new king seemed the antithesis of his careful and suspicious father, and he lost no time in making his Court the most colourful and extravagant in Europe. Yet this glamorous exterior only partly disguised the unpredictable and savagely ruthless nature of the King, and as his reign developed, these traits were to become increasingly evident. Henry’s desperate efforts to father a legitimate male heir for his kingdom led him to marry six times, to make himself Supreme Head of the English Church as well as absolute ruler of the State, and to cut down or cast aside all those who stood in his way, or who failed to carry out his wishes.
Robert Lacey traces the story of this bizarre figure from his vigorous youth to gross and immobile old age. We see Henry as the absolute ruler who raised the English monarchy to a pinnacle of arbitrary power, which it never achieved again, as the centre of a Court of immense brilliance and talent, and as a man who, despite his cruelty and unpredictability, could inspire men with loyalty and devotion to the end. |
| Author:
Robert Lacey was educated at Bristol Grammar School and Selwyn College, Cambridge. He was Assistant Editor of the Sunday Times Magazine. In 1971 his first book, ‘Robert, Earl of Essex, An Elizabethan Icarus’ was published. |
